Does candy ever go bad?

Can you eat expired candy

Most candies do have expiration dates, but like most foods, these dates serve more as guidelines for when to consume them. It's generally fine to eat candy past its expiration date, though the quality and texture does decline after a certain point.

Will Halloween candy last a year

Hard candy like Jolly Ranchers, lollipops and other individually wrapped candies can essentially last forever if they're stored right and kept away from moisture. Dark chocolate can last one to two years in a cool, dark, dry place. Milk and white chocolate will last up to 10 months.

Is candy still good after 2 years

“Yes, candy does expire, but the good news is that most types of candy are good to eat for six to 12 months,” says registered oncology dietician, Kaitlin Mckenzie. The shelf life of a candy also depends on the type of candy and where you store it.

Do chocolates expire

As bacteria can't live in chocolate, chocolates don't have a use by date. Even if a bloom does appear, or your chocolate has a peculiar smell to it, it will still be safe to consume.

What candy takes the longest to expire

Candy Shelf Life Guidelines:Hard Candy: 12 months.Jelly Beans: six months.Jordan Almonds: two months.Licorice: two months.Lollipops: 12 months.Milk or White Chocolate: three months.Mints: 24 months.Novelty Candy: 12 months.

Can you eat 20 year old chocolate

“First of all, the water activity of chocolate is very low, which means microorganisms cannot grow in chocolate. So unless the chocolate was contaminated with microorganisms to begin with there should be no issue with microbial spoilage, even after 20 years.

Can you eat 10 year old chocolate

Dark chocolate, with its higher cacao content, can be good to eat for as long as three years past the best before. Due to their high milk contents, milk and white chocolates might not last as long as dark, but their longevity is still nothing to sniff at — you can expect to get another 8 months or so out of it.

How much candy is too much for a 13 year old

Based on links to high blood pressure, obesity and diabetes, the AHA recommends that kids over the age of two consume no more than 25 grams (6 teaspoons) of added sugars a day. Children under two should avoid consuming added sugars. It doesn't take much Halloween candy to hit these sugar limits.
